The emergence of digital sports streaming platforms has fundamentally altered how audiences consume sports coverage worldwide. These pioneering services have opened up accessibility previously restricted broadcasts, allowing viewers to view games and tournaments from virtually anywhere with a web connection. Major streaming services have invested billions in obtaining broadcasting licenses for premier sporting events, fueling intense rivalry among broadcast entities. The versatility provided by these platforms allows fans to customise their watching experience through features such as multiple visual angles, instant replays, and personalised material recommendations. Live sports coverage has absolutely been transformed using leading-edge broadcast tools providing exceptional visual and audio clarity to viewers. Ultra-high-definition cameras, advanced microphone systems, and sophisticated editing equipment allow production teams to record every instant of sporting events with remarkable accuracy. The use of digital reality and augmented analyses systems has present immersive viewing experiences that situate fans virtually within arenas and venues. Drone equipment has effectively expanded the artistic options for recording sky footage and unique perspectives formerly out of reach or prohibitively costly. Real-time data synergy enables broadcasters to overlay data-driven info, player details, and tactical analysis directly onto the live feed, establishing an engaging educational viewing experience.

Commentary and sports analysis has also progressed significantly with the incorporation of advanced technical tools and information analytics. Modern analysts now have access to real-time statistics, check here player tracking information, and sophisticated analytical software that improves their ability to provide insightful observations throughout broadcasts. The depth of analysis accessible has transformed commentary from simple play-by-play accounts to in-depth tactical breakdowns that engage viewers. Advanced graphics software allow commentators to illustrate sophisticated tactics and player movements with graphic aids that make the sport more accessible to informal fans.
